bully to frighten or hurt.
commander an officer who is the leader of a military unit.
diagram a drawing or plan that shows the parts of something or how the parts work together.
equal having the same value, measure, or amount as something else.
folk people in general.
frown to wrinkle your forehead when you are angry or not happy.
handle to do what needs to be done with something or someone; manage; control.
heat the form of energy that you feel as warmth.
insect a small animal whose body is divided into three parts. Insects also have three pairs of legs and usually one or two pairs of wings. Bees, ants, butterflies, beetles, and flies are some kinds of insects.
nightmare a frightening dream.
pity sympathy or sorrow caused by another's pain, bad luck, or suffering.
plenty a full amount or supply.
schedule to set the date or time of.
stupid dull or slow to learn; not smart.
suppose to assume to be true in order to make clear or to explain.
